French firm to create 267 jobs in Kilkenny and Wicklow

A leading French pharmaceutical company has announced plans to create 267 new jobs in Kilkenny and Wicklow over the coming years.

Servier says 155 of the jobs will be created at a new €115m facility in Belview, on the Kilkenny/Waterford border.

The other 112 will be created as part of a €69m expansion of its existing operations in Arklow, where 206 people are currently employed.
